What We Offer in Ayr

For airport and runway applications in Ayr, Stardom Ltd utilises track pavers to achieve the precise tolerances required for aviation surfaces. The company deploys a fleet of three Vögele pavers, including the Super 1800-5, a highway-class machine with a 10m width capable of laying 700 tonnes per hour, alongside the Super 1803-3i and the compact Super 1303-3i midi. These machines are essential for laying asphalt on runways, taxiways, aprons, and aircraft stands with the consistency and density necessary to withstand extreme aircraft loads. The surfacing process involves strict material specification and compaction control, managed by a team of over 20 skilled professionals, all holding CSCS cards. The Vögele track pavers, manufactured by the Wirtgen Group, ensure a smooth, even surface with minimal segregation, which is critical for aircraft braking performance and safety.
